about summary refs log tree commit diff
diff options
context:
space:
mode:
authorAlyssa Ross <hi@alyssa.is>2023-02-08 15:32:53 +0000
committerAlyssa Ross <hi@alyssa.is>2023-06-05 20:43:56 +0000
commitfb3cd36c21c92d6c241fa0855401481fb013d6d1 (patch)
tree418bb4691b38115b155912bef1842df9c0b55ce1
parent1e53f6702ad0e41b563fd33ea769931ab23e7c3d (diff)
downloadnix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.tar
nix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.tar.gz
nix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.tar.bz2
nix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.tar.lz
nix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.tar.xz
nix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.tar.zst
nixlib-fb3cd36c21c92d6c241fa0855401481fb013d6d1.zip
castnow: wrap with ffmpeg
Required for --tomp4.
-rw-r--r--nixpkgs/pkgs/development/node-packages/overrides.nix9
1 files changed, 9 insertions, 0 deletions
diff --git a/nixpkgs/pkgs/development/node-packages/overrides.nix b/nixpkgs/pkgs/development/node-packages/overrides.nix
index 5ce8bfcfb81d..a7cb01c5d77d 100644
--- a/nixpkgs/pkgs/development/node-packages/overrides.nix
+++ b/nixpkgs/pkgs/development/node-packages/overrides.nix
@@ -128,6 +128,15 @@ final: prev: {
     meta = oldAttrs.meta // { broken = since "12"; };
   });
 
+  castnow = prev.castnow.override {
+    nativeBuildInputs = [ pkgs.makeWrapper ];
+
+    postInstall = ''
+      wrapProgram "$out/bin/castnow" \
+          --prefix PATH : ${pkgs.lib.makeBinPath [ pkgs.ffmpeg ]}
+    '';
+  };
+
   deltachat-desktop = prev."deltachat-desktop-../../applications/networking/instant-messengers/deltachat-desktop".override (oldAttrs: {
     meta = oldAttrs.meta // { broken = true; }; # use the top-level package instead
   });